Oracle IDM组件带来强大的身份管理能力(oracle idm组件)
Oracle IDM组件带来强大的身份管理能力
身份管理是当今企业数据安全领域中不可或缺的一环。随着企业的规模不断扩大,用户数量的急剧增加和复杂的软件系统的部署,一种系统化、标准化的身份管理解决方案越来越成为必需品。在众多的身份管理方案中,Oracle IDM组件因其功能强大被广泛地应用于企业级身份管理领域。
Oracle IDM组件是Oracle公司为解决企业级身份管理问题而推出的一套完整的身份管理解决方案。Oracle IDM组件不仅包括标准身份管理功能(如账户管理、密码管理等),还涵盖了角色、访问控制、审计、认证等多方面的解决方案。
Oracle IDM组件的一个核心特点就是其关于角色和权限管理的能力。角色是企业中的重要概念,每个员工只拥有自己所负责的一部分角色,不会同时拥有所有角色。在Oracle IDM组件中,通过定义角色和用户的对应关系,管理员可以迅速地将相应角色的权限分配给新增加的用户。
而在权限管理方面,Oracle IDM组件的能力也非常强大。Oracle IDM组件可以智能分析访问控制的要求,并对用户进行自动授权,有效地保护企业的数据防火墙。此外,Oracle IDM组件还能够实现多种认证方式,包括基于密码、数字证书或生物特征等多种方式的认证,为企业提供了更完善的安全保障。
除此之外,在实现企业级身份管理方案中,Oracle IDM组件还提供多种扩展方法和工具,可以非常方便地与其他系统和应用集成,大大提高了系统的灵活性和可扩展性。例如,通过与Oracle数据库集成,企业可以更快速地实现统一身份认证。
Oracle IDM组件带来的身份管理能力是非常强大而灵活的,可以帮助企业提高数据的安全性和可控性。Oracle也在不断地完善和扩展其身份管理解决方案,使之可以更好地满足企业不断变化的身份管理需求。
相关代码:
以下是基于Oracle IDM组件的简单示例代码:
//定义角色
myRole = new oracle.iam.platform.entity.bean.Role();myRole.setName("Admin");
//定义用户myUser = new oracle.iam.identity.usermgmt.vo.User();
myUser.setId("1001");myUser.setFirstName("John");
myUser.setLastName("Smith");
//将角色分配给用户RoleGrantManager roleGrantManager = Platform.getService(RoleGrantManager.class);
roleGrantManager.grantRole(myUser.getId(), myRole.getName(), null);